首页 > 其他分享 >Pentaho Report Design发布报表到Pentaho Server

Pentaho Report Design发布报表到Pentaho Server

时间:2023-08-08 11:35:18浏览次数:42  
标签:字段 Server 发布 Design Report Pentaho


我们在前面两章分别学习了

windows安装Pentaho Report Design
Pentaho Report Design设计柱状图
windows安装Pentaho Server

本章来学习Pentaho Report Design发布报表到Pentaho Server。

Pentaho Report Design准备报表

使用Pentaho Report Design设计好报表之后需要呈现给其他人看时,最好就是发布到Pentaho Server中,Pentaho Report Design可以很方便的完成这个操作。

例如我们已经设计好了share.prpt图表,使用Pentaho Report Design打开后如图所示:

Pentaho Report Design发布报表到Pentaho Server_数据仓库

预览如图所示:

Pentaho Report Design发布报表到Pentaho Server_字段_02

发布到Pentaho Server

菜单选择File - Publish

Pentaho Report Design发布报表到Pentaho Server_html_03

然后输入Pentaho BI地址和用户名、密码:

Pentaho Report Design发布报表到Pentaho Server_Server_04

然后填写发布名称、路径,等,可以新建文件夹:

Pentaho Report Design发布报表到Pentaho Server_html_05

发布成功会提醒查看:

Pentaho Report Design发布报表到Pentaho Server_数据仓库_06

查看效果如图,左上角可以调整输出类型:

Pentaho Report Design发布报表到Pentaho Server_数据仓库_07

Pentaho Server打开已发布的图表

我们刚才是在发布完成后直接跳转到发布的图表,那么有没有办法直接在Pentaho Server打开已发布的图表呢?

答案是肯定的。

需要刷新Pentaho Server页面才会加载到新发布的图表。

刷新之后 File————>Open找到刚才发布的文件即可。

Pentaho Report Design发布报表到Pentaho Server_html_08

可能遇到的问题1

文件夹无法新建,或者新建无效。这个可能是用户权限的问题,有些目录下不允许新建文件夹,请在Home目录下新建即可。

可能遇到的问题2

pdf预览没问题的图表发布到线上后 用html查看 有些字段不显示,字段为空白。

首先需要确认的是发布到线上之后用用html模式查看有问题的图表在本地Pentaho Report Design中使用html模式查看肯定也是有问题的。

原因是 有些字段会被其他字段遮挡,被遮挡的字段在pdf模式中查看可能没问题,在html模式查看则会空白。

诊断的方法是看在 设计器中字段是否为红色透明底,如下:

Pentaho Report Design发布报表到Pentaho Server_html_09

这种情况title字段就是被遮挡的,解决方法是 左右上下移动字段的问题,保证字段有足够的空间。

正常的情况 字段显示如下:

Pentaho Report Design发布报表到Pentaho Server_字段_10


标签:字段,Server,发布,Design,Report,Pentaho
From: https://blog.51cto.com/u_16218512/7006269

相关文章

  • Pentaho Report Design设计柱状图
    我们在上一章节已经安装了PentahoReportDesign,现在使用它来设计柱状图。新建bar模版如果才打开,可以看到有一些Samples模版可以选择,直接点击Charts和Bar即可。如图:或者新建一个空白的report模版,然后选中左边工具栏的chart工具,拖动到ReportHeader中,并拖动产生的图标调整大小。......
  • Siemens SERVER 2016中安装WINCC 7.5 SP1
     一、查询WINCC兼容性列表,得知WINCC7.5可以在SERVER2016中安装,且与SIMATICNETV16兼容:二、了解了系统及软件的兼容性之后,开始准备操作系统及软件。1.安装VMware虚拟机,内容略过……2.部署英文版WindowsServer2016系统;3.安装中文语言包;4.安装消息队列、IIS、NetFramew......
  • SqlServer时间格式化
       sqlserver日期格式化中文-年月日selectconvert(varchar,datepart(yy,getdate()))+N'年'+convert(varchar,datepart(mm,getdate()))+N'月'+convert(varchar,datepart(dd,getdate()))+N'日',cast(datepart(yy,getdate())asvarchar)+N'年......
  • 调用Geoserver发布的图层中文字段显示乱码
    通过OL使用WFS服务,调用发布的图层字段,中文字段显示为乱码  有几种原因:①指定打印的字符格式在代码中指定输出的编码格式,例如使用console.log('@@xxx',xzq.toString('utf-8'))来指定输出为UTF-8编码格式。②添加meta如果是在网页中输出乱码,可以在HTML的<head>标......
  • 服务器数据恢复-断电导致XenServer虚拟磁盘文件丢失的数据恢复案例
    服务器数据恢复环境:某单位一台Dell服务器上使用RAID卡搭建了一组由4盘RAID10。服务器安装的XenServer虚拟化操作系统,虚拟机采用的WindowsServer操作系统。共系统盘和数据盘两个虚拟机磁盘,上层部署的是Web服务器(ASP+SQLServer架构)。服务器故障&分析:由于服务器突然断电,服务器......
  • Windows server 2003怎么安装iisWindows server 2003安装IIS教程
    Windows2008系统服务器安装IIS之前已经分享过了,和Windows2003完全不同,今天我将详细地和你分享Windowsserver2003卸载和安装IIS的步骤方法,希望可以帮助到你~1、首先进入服务器,确定下服务器是否有安装IIS,有安装IIS,需要重装的,可以先将IIS卸载。2、卸载比安装更简单些,点击开始——......
  • MySQL问题记录Can't connect to MySQL server on 'localhost' (10061)解决方法
    登录MySQL提示Can'tconnecttoMySQLserveron'localhost'(10061)进入安装目录bin目录,执行mysqld--install,启动MySQL点击查看代码cdD:\soft\MySQL\MySQLServer5.7\binmysqld--installnetstartmysql提示启动失败最后执行mysqld--initialize--user=root--......
  • $_SERVER 全局变量内容详解
    echo"<h1>服务器</h1>";//**********************  服务器  *********************echo $_SERVER['SERVER_NAME']."<br />";     //服务器的名称echo $_SERVER['SERVER_ADDR']."<br />";     //服务器的ipecho ......
  • 如何将 Microsoft Access 数据转移到 SQL Server 数据库
    在本文中,我们将为您提供一个包含屏幕截图的分步教程,介绍如何使用dborgeStudioforSQLServer 将MicrosoftAccess数据库转换为SQLServer。这个GUI工具几乎可以增强使用数据库的每个方面,包括数据库设计、SQL编码、数据库比较、模式和数据同步、有用测试数据的生成以及许多......
  • C#实现SqlServer数据库同步
    实现效果:设计思路:1.开启数据库及表的cdc,定时查询cdc表数据,封装sql语句(通过执行类型,主键;修改类型的cdc数据只取最后更新的记录),添加到离线数据表;2.线程定时查询离线数据表,更新远程库数据;3.远程库数据被更改又会产生cdc数据,对此数据进行拦截;配置文件说明:{ "AsyncInterval":......